Proxy ARP and DHCP Relay Overwrite redirect traffic through the firewall for inspection and policy enforcement. For scenarios where devices share same Layer 2 broadcast domain, they communicate at Layer 2 without passing through a Layer 3 gateway, which means the firewall lacks visibility into or control over that traffic. This lack of visibility creates a security enforcement gap that allows unrestricted lateral movement between devices. This is particularly concerning in flat network environments, such as operational technology (OT) networks, industrial control systems, and manufacturing environments, where devices like programmable logic controllers, sensors, and engineering workstations share a single broadcast domain.
The following two mechanisms address this gap but work differently depending on how devices obtain their IP addresses:
  • Proxy ARP (Address Resolution Protocol) is a technique where a network device (usually a router) answers ARP queries on behalf of another device.
  • DHCP Relay Overwrite modifies the subnet mask and default gateway values in DHCP responses before the firewall forwards them to clients.
Once traffic passes through the firewall, the full range of security capabilities is available for enforcement, including App-ID™, User-ID™, Device-ID, Threat Prevention, WildFire®, and Device Security.
To implement this feature, configure Proxy ARP on the Layer 3 interface and configure DHCP Relay Overwrite on the DHCP relay interface. After configuration, verify that the traffic is passing through the firewall and matching your security policy rules.
